Understanding the Types of Car Keys
Before diving into the services readily available for lost car keys, it is vital to comprehend the different types of car keys and their performances.
Kind of Key
Description
Functions
Conventional Key
A fundamental metal key that operates the lock mechanism.
Basic style, no electronic devices.
Transponder Key
A key with a chip that communicates with the car's ignition system.
Supplies extra security.
Key Fob
A remote that unlocks/starts the car. Typically consists of transponder innovation.
Includes buttons for remote functions.
Smart Key
A keyless entry system that allows distance access and starting the engine without placing a key.
Advanced innovation, benefit.

Lost Car Key Services: Options Available
When chauffeurs discover themselves in the predicament of losing their car keys, numerous service choices can help them, including:
1. Locksmith Services
Locksmiths specialize in lock and key problems and can offer support with lost car keys. Numerous professional locksmith professionals provide services straight at the vehicle's area.
- Benefits:
- Can frequently produce a brand-new key on-site.
- May not need pulling the car.
- Typically more economical than dealership options.
2. Dealership Services
Contacting the vehicle's maker or a certified dealer is another alternative for lost key replacement.
- Advantages:
- Provides original devices producer (OEM) keys.
- Can deal with the more intricate electronic keys.
- Services frequently include reprogramming the vehicle's ignition system.
3. Mobile Key Replacement Services
Some companies specialize in mobile key replacement, focusing particularly on lost or broken car keys.
- Benefits:
- Convenience given that they pertain to the vehicle's area.
- Quick turn-around time; often completed within an hour.
- Competitive rates compared to car dealerships.
4. Insurance coverage Providers
In specific cases, car insurance plan might cover the cost of lost key replacement.
- Benefits:
- Can lower out-of-pocket expenses.
- Policies may cover locksmith costs or dealer expenses.
5. Roadside Assistance Services
Numerous roadside assistance prepares deal lockout services that can help in the event of a lost key.
- Benefits:
- Instant assistance may be offered through the existing provider.
- Typically consisted of in vehicle service warranties or membership strategies (e.g., AAA).

FAQs About Lost Car Key Services
Q1: How much does it typically cost to replace a lost car key?
The cost can vary significantly based upon the kind of key and the service company. Conventional keys can range from ₤ 50 to ₤ 150, while smart keys might cost upwards of ₤ 300.
Q2: Can I program a brand-new car key myself?
Some vehicles do permit self-programming of keys, however many modern keys need specific tools and software application that only dealers or automotive locksmith professionals have.
Q3: How long does it take to replace a lost car key?
The time needed to replace a lost car key differs; a locksmith can typically offer a new key on-site within an hour, while car dealership replacements might take longer due to inventory checks and programming procedures.
Q4: Will losing my key affect my car insurance premium?
Usually, losing your keys does not straight affect your car insurance premium unless you sue for protection associated to key replacement expenses.
